The Beechcraft Model 19 Musketeer Sport was an economical training aircraft that provided affordable entry into general aviation during the late 1960s and 1970s. First flown as part of the Musketeer family prototype in 1961, it was a low-wing single-engine monoplane powered by a 150-horsepower Lycoming O-320 engine that could seat two to four occupants. Measuring just over 25 feet in length with fixed tricycle landing gear, the Model 19 was manufactured by Beech Aircraft Corporation from 1966 to 1979.
